From source file:com.wudaosoft.net.httpclient.DefaultHostConfig.java
public DefaultHostConfig() { defaultRequestConfig = RequestConfig.custom().setExpectContinueEnabled(false) // .setStaleConnectionCheckEnabled(true) .setTargetPreferredAuthSchemes(Arrays.asList(AuthSchemes.NTLM, AuthSchemes.DIGEST)) .setProxyPreferredAuthSchemes(Arrays.asList(AuthSchemes.BASIC)).setConnectionRequestTimeout(500) .setConnectTimeout(10000).setSocketTimeout(10000).build(); }
From source file:io.cloudslang.content.httpclient.build.auth.AuthSchemeProviderLookupBuilderTest.java
@Test public void buildLookupWithDigestAuth() { AuthSchemeProvider provider = getAuthSchemeProvider(AuthSchemes.DIGEST); assertThat(provider, instanceOf(DigestSchemeFactory.class)); }

From source file:com.datatorrent.stram.util.WebServicesClient.java
public static void initAuth(ConfigProvider configuration) { // Setting up BASIC and DIGEST auth setupUserPassAuthScheme(AuthScheme.BASIC, AuthSchemes.BASIC, new BasicSchemeFactory(), configuration); setupUserPassAuthScheme(AuthScheme.DIGEST, AuthSchemes.DIGEST, new DigestSchemeFactory(), configuration); // Adding kerberos standard auth setupHttpAuthScheme(AuthSchemes.KERBEROS, new KerberosSchemeFactory(), AuthScope.ANY, DEFAULT_TOKEN_CREDENTIALS);//from w ww .j av a 2 s . com authRegistry = registryBuilder.build(); }
